Summary: Unabridged and relived
Comment: Simon and Schuster present the original, unabridged tale of Peter Pan by J.M. Barrie to a new generation of readers. The 1911 tale is in a large sized book with 134 pages and colorfully illustrated life-like pictures.
I remember the story of Wendy Darling, her brothers, parents, Peter Pan, Tinkerbell, Neverland, the mermaids, Tiger Lily, and all the wonderful situations that made up this animated fairytale in print. From the moment Wendy and Peter Pan meet, to the first flight, to the trips to Neverland and all the escapades that followed, to the end with a grown up Wendy and her own child -- it's all here in the manner in which it was really meant to be told. It's too unique to be missed by young or old. Rereading it as a grown-up was a magical experience.
Although I see nothing wrong with the Disney adaptation of Peter Pan, I am glad to see the original version back in fresh print. There isn't anything in Peter Pan I feel would affect young children, it's just a lengthy tale that would most likely take a week of bedtime reads to finish.

Summary: Neverland Comes to Life!
Comment: This edition of Barrie's classic novel ushers in a new era in illustrated books. Combining photography and state-of-the-art computer wizardry with an illustrator's sensibility that descends directly from the work of such artists as N.C. Wyeth, Arthur Rackham, and Maxfield Parrish, Raquel Jaramillo has brought the tale of Peter Pan and Neverland magically to life. Children will be enthralled by the immediacy and realism of the pictures--able, finally, to see the 'real' Peter, Hook, and Tinker Bell--while adults will appreciate the artistry of her interpretations. This is the original, unabridged novel, though Jaramillo has cleverly found a way to highlight key textual points with captions that can be read aloud to younger fans. This book is a triumph, a joy for young and old alike!

Summary: Success of digital photo in storytelling.
Comment: I've read the story/play before getting this book, and I must say the digital images really elaborates a new wave of magic. The digital imaging photographs are great in company with the writing. The colors are fantastic and the typography really promotes the tension of the plotline. For any illustration or fine art student this is one book you must have for reference. It is like taking Disney's Peter Pan into live action, except with lesser background scenes.
